Temperature Conversion Formulas

From Fahrenheit to Celsius: T°C = (T°F - 32) / 1.8

For example:
To convert 68°F to Celsius, subtract 32 from 68 to get 36. Then divide 36 by 1.8, which is equal to 20°C.

From Celsius to Fahrenheit: T°F = (T°C * 1.8) + 32

For example:
To convert 20°C to Fahrenheit, multiply 20 by 1.8, which is equal to 36. Then add 32 to get the result of 68°F.

From Celsius to Kelvin: TK = T°C + 273.15

From Kelvin to Celsius: T°C = TK - 273.15

There are simpler calculations methods for conversion between Celsius and Fahrenheit that are not as precise as the exact formulas, but can be suitable for quick approximations and mental calculations. Here are the steps:

To convert from Celsius to Fahrenheit:

  1. Multiply the Celsius temperature by 2;
  2. Add 32 to the result.

To convert from Fahrenheit to Celsius:

  1. Subtract 32 from the Fahrenheit temperature;
  2. Divide the result by 2.
